>> On 10/25/18, Erik Gaudin <erik.gaudin at cbc.ca> wrote:
>> > How to display Close Caption on the screen  ?
>> >
>> > When i open our internal stream with VLC, i can displayed Substitle. But
>> > can't find how to do it with ffplay.exe (windows)
>> >
>> > Here what i use to display the stream : ffplay
>> > udp://@239.255.123.1:1234 -analyzeduration
>> > 200
>> >
>> > I use the last argument for low latency.
>> >
>> >
>> > Here what appear in DOS when start FFPLAY with URL only :
>> >
>> > Input #0, mpegts, from 'udp://@239.255.179.6:5000':q=    0B f=0/0
>> >   Duration: N/A, start: 86892.634178, bitrate: N/A
>> >   Program 2672
>> >     Stream #0:0[0xa72]: Video: hevc (Main) ([36][0][0][0] / 0x0024),
>> > yuv420p(tv), 1280x720 [SAR 1:1 DAR 16:9], Closed Captions, 59.94 fps,
>> 59.94
>> > tbr, 90k tbn, 59.94 tbc
>> >     Stream #0:1[0xa73](eng): Audio: aac_latm (LC) ([17][0][0][0] /
>> 0x0011),
>> > 48000 Hz, stereo, fltp
>> >     Stream #0:2[0xa74](fre): Audio: aac_latm (LC) ([17][0][0][0] /
>> 0x0011),
>> > 48000 Hz, stereo, fltp
>> >
>> >
>> > In VLC, CC are in Flux # 3  (Flux 0 = video, Flux 1 & 2 Audio track)
>> >
>> > I try multiple argument ( like -sst) but nothing happen. Any idea ?
>>
>> FFplay is very rudimentary player, it does not support subtitles or
>> caption out of box.
>>
>> Use something much more powerful like mpv.
